

Atomic Form
NFT Display
Atomic Form partnered with our team to create a high-end digital display and casting box connected directly to the Ethereum blockchain. We developed the hardware and software to securely link the network to the blockchain, authenticate NFTs, and connect artists and customers. The Wave display allows users to manage their art gallery, while the Photon casting box connects to existing devices like smart TVs or monitors, easily managed through desktop or mobile browsers. Atomic Form's devices have garnered significant interest, winning a CES Award in 2022 and securing seed funding from investors like Samsung Next and Global Capital.
